Transaction e8573cf90f3928c61e79e9e8b65a66a5aa9efa5f44a95808e0cfdbb8bd08547d

1 Input
2 Outputs
  • e8573cf90f3928c61e79e9e8b65a66a5aa9efa5f44a95808e0cfdbb8bd08547d:0
  • value  252455059
    address  1ExVDaaYA9fi4W4j92mChPTkCbCK7sa3vz
  • e8573cf90f3928c61e79e9e8b65a66a5aa9efa5f44a95808e0cfdbb8bd08547d:1
  • value  155710600
    address  12sJHSkdWMnU6oFErEAhXxHRWZja2EhwKF